Job Summary and Qualifications

The Physical Therapist (PT) provides high-quality, patient-centered care by managing the complete process of therapeutic care of an assigned group of patients in coordination with the physician and the patient care team. The Physical Therapist completes patient assessments and participates in developing and implementing individualized care plans focusing on goal achievement, patient engagement, and positive patient experience. The Physical Therapist provides or directs a majority of the patient's physical therapy to support patients throughout the continuum of care.

As a Physical Therapist at our facility you willfind out what it truly means to be a part of a collaborative team where diversity and inclusion thrive. Every role has an impact on our patients' lives and you have the opportunity to make a difference. Join us in our efforts to better our community In this role:

·You will be responsible for evaluation, planning, directing and administering physical therapy modalities of treatment as prescribed by a licensed physician.

·You will be responsible for understanding current treatment philosophy and procedures and documenting treatments in a compliant manner.

·You will assist patients in reaching their maximum performance and level of functioning, while learning to live within the limits of their capabilities.

·You will instruct and supervise Students, Physical Therapy Assistants and Physical Therapy Aides in the proper handling and treatment of assigned patients.

·You will participate in operational aspects of the department, including performance improvement activities within the department and CQI activities.

·You will attend staff and other meetings and participate in unit committees, such as education, quality improvement, etc.

·You will maintain up-to-date knowledge of trends in physical therapy and participate in program development, development of new procedures, service lines, and changes as needed.

Qualifications:

·Graduate of an accredited Physical Therapy program.

·Current State of Alaska Physical Therapist license.

·American Red Cross or American Heart Association Basic Life Support

Course (BLS or BCLS) and Certification

·Acute and Rehabilitation experience of one year is preferred.
